Physical Property
Refractive Index
n20/D 1.4432(lit.)
Vapor Density
8.3 (vs air)
Melting Point
13-16 °C(lit.)
Density
0.799 g/mL at 25 °C(lit.)
Flash Point
>230 °F
>110 °C
Vapor Pressure
0.01 mmHg ( 20 °C)
Boiling Point
297-298 °C(lit.)
